Within Global Indirect Procurement (GIP), the Audit and Compliance Programs Lead manages third party supplier compliance, and is accountable for leading GIP compliance programs, such as: SOX audits and SOX controls management on behalf of GIP Performance of supplier System and Organization Controls (SOC) report assessment Management and attestation on quarterly Internal Controls over Financial Reporting (ICFR) for the procurement application Procure360 Coordination and support of Internal, External, and Quality audits in the AMS region, and globally as required Management of global After the Fact (ATF) PO program including ATF PO reporting, monitoring, offender and infraction frequency tracking, automation of education letter distribution, policy education, monthly ATF PO KPI reporting Indirect Procurement Business Controls and Continuity Assurance Emerging Risk Assessment and Mitigation Strategy Development Collaboration with Stakeholders and suppliers to influence, strategize and implement compliance programs that meet regulatory requirements, mitigate risk to HP and elevate supplier compliance with HP’s Supplier Code of Conduct and other relevant standards. In addition, Audit and Compliance Programs Lead exercises a unique mastery and recognized authority on relevant subject matter knowledge including internal and external end to end audit management, confidently represents GIP policies, processes and tools in the course of internal and external audit fieldwork, defends GIP position with the audit teams, makes the right judgement in alignment with GIP Teams when acknowledging an audit issue, tracks GIP owned audit issues and drives timely and effective resolution engaging the relevant GIP and HP teams, presents the audit issue resolution evidence to the Audit Managers.
